2. Practice Mental Calculations

Relying on pen and paper for every calculation can slow you down. Developing mental math skills will help in solving questions faster.

Techniques to Improve Mental Calculation:

  • Learn multiplication tables, squares, and cubes up to 30.
  • Use approximation techniques for quick calculations.
  • Apply Vedic math tricks for faster multiplication and division.
  • Practice mental math exercises daily for 15 minutes.

Example: Instead of calculating 48×5248 \times 5248×52 manually, use the formula:
(50−2)(50+2)=502−22=2500−4=2496(50 - 2)(50 + 2) = 50^2 - 2^2 = 2500 - 4 = 2496(502)(50+2)=50222=25004=2496

Pro Tip: Practice calculations in daily tasks such as grocery shopping or budgeting to build natural speed.

4. Develop Shortcut Techniques and Tricks

Learning shortcuts and tricks can drastically improve your solving speed.

Key Shortcuts to Focus On:

  • Percentage Conversion: Use fraction equivalents for quick calculations (e.g., 25% = 1/4).
  • Unitary Method: Apply for time-speed-distance and work problems.
  • Algebraic Identities: Memorize and use them efficiently.
  • Approximation Strategies: Round off values for quick calculations.

Example Question:
Find 23% of 1450 quickly.

Instead of lengthy multiplication, break it down:
23%=20%+3%23\% = 20\% + 3\%23%=20%+3%
20% of 1450=29020\% \text{ of } 1450 = 29020% of 1450=290
3% of 1450=43.53\% \text{ of } 1450 = 43.53% of 1450=43.5
Total=290+43.5=333.5\text{Total} = 290 + 43.5 = 333.5Total=290+43.5=333.5

6. Prioritize Question Selection

Attempting the right questions first can save valuable time in the exam.

Smart Approach:

  • Categorize questions into easy, moderate, and difficult at a glance.
  • Solve easier questions first to secure quick marks.
  • Skip time-consuming questions and revisit them later if time permits.

Pro Tip: Follow the 2-minute rule—if a question takes more than 2 minutes, move on and return if time allows.
